What is the best way to convert metric units (I'm really bad at this...)

Necesitas reconocer los múltiplos u submúltiplos del sistema métrico decimal si son lineales por cada nivel que avanzas multiplicas o divides con el 10
siempre y cuando la unidad de medida es el metro ese queda al centro.
Km Hm Dam m dm cm mm yo los ubico en escalera el metro queda al centro y de cualquier lugar que te posicionas,buscas a donde quieres convertir y revisas si vas a la derecha multiplicas por 10 o si vas a la izquierda divides entre 10 siempre y cuando sea un lugar a donde te vas a mover si son dos lugares es con el 100 por que 10x10 es 100 y si son tres lugares es con el 1000 porque es 10x10x10.
ejemplo 2000m convertirlos a Hm= 20 Hm dividí 2000 entre 100 porque me moví 2 lugares a la izquierda  otro ejem. 100 Dam convertirlos a cm=100000 porque 100x 1000 por que avance 3 lugares a la derecha

under a dilation, the point (2,6) is moved to (6,18) what is the scale factor of the dilation? enter your answer in the box​
Anestetic [448]
<h2>3</h2>

Step-by-step explanation:

The equation of line passing through the two points is \frac{y-y_{1} }{x-x_{1} }=\frac{y_{2} -y_{1}}{x_{2} -x_{1}}

When substituted,the equation becomes \frac{y-6}{x-2}=\frac{18-6}{6-2}

which when simplified is y=3\times x

The line clearly passes through origin.

The distance between two points is \sqrt{(y_{1}-y_{2} )^{2}+(x_{1}- x_{2} )^{2}}

Distance between origin and (2,6) is \sqrt{40}.

Distance between origin and (6,18) is \sqrt{360}

Scale factor is  \frac{distance\text{ }of\text{ }p_{2}\text{ from origin}}{distance \text{ } of \text{ } p_{1}\text{ from origin}}

So,scale factor is \frac{\sqrt{360} }{\sqrt{40} }

which when simplified becomes 3.
